2799ace16cdSJacob Faibussowitsch /*MC
28049c86fc7SBarry Smith   PetscCall - Calls a PETSc function and then checks the resulting error code, if it is non-zero it calls the error
28149c86fc7SBarry Smith   handler and returns from the current function with the error code.
2829566063dSJacob Faibussowitsch 
2839566063dSJacob Faibussowitsch   Synopsis:
2849566063dSJacob Faibussowitsch   #include <petscerror.h>
28549c86fc7SBarry Smith   void PetscCall(PetscFunction(args))
2869566063dSJacob Faibussowitsch 
2879566063dSJacob Faibussowitsch   Not Collective
2889566063dSJacob Faibussowitsch 
2899566063dSJacob Faibussowitsch   Input Parameter:
29049c86fc7SBarry Smith . PetscFunction - any PETSc function that returns an error code
2919566063dSJacob Faibussowitsch 
2929566063dSJacob Faibussowitsch   Notes:
2939566063dSJacob Faibussowitsch   Once the error handler is called the calling function is then returned from with the given
2949566063dSJacob Faibussowitsch   error code. Experienced users can set the error handler with PetscPushErrorHandler().
2959566063dSJacob Faibussowitsch 
2966aad120cSJose E. Roman   PetscCall() cannot be used in functions returning a datatype not convertible to
2979566063dSJacob Faibussowitsch   PetscErrorCode. For example, PetscCall() may not be used in functions returning void, use
2989566063dSJacob Faibussowitsch   PetscCallVoid() in this case.
2999566063dSJacob Faibussowitsch 
3009566063dSJacob Faibussowitsch   Example Usage:
3019566063dSJacob Faibussowitsch .vb
3029566063dSJacob Faibussowitsch   PetscCall(PetscInitiailize(...)); // OK to call even when PETSc is not yet initialized!
3039566063dSJacob Faibussowitsch 
3049566063dSJacob Faibussowitsch   struct my_struct
3059566063dSJacob Faibussowitsch   {
3069566063dSJacob Faibussowitsch     void *data;
3079566063dSJacob Faibussowitsch   } my_complex_type;
3089566063dSJacob Faibussowitsch 
3099566063dSJacob Faibussowitsch   struct my_struct bar(void)
3109566063dSJacob Faibussowitsch   {
3116aad120cSJose E. Roman     PetscCall(foo(15)); // ERROR PetscErrorCode not convertible to struct my_struct!
3129566063dSJacob Faibussowitsch   }
3139566063dSJacob Faibussowitsch 
3146aad120cSJose E. Roman   PetscCall(bar()) // ERROR input not convertible to PetscErrorCode
3159566063dSJacob Faibussowitsch .ve
3169566063dSJacob Faibussowitsch 
317ef1023bdSBarry Smith   It is also possible to call this directly on a PetscErrorCode variable
31849c86fc7SBarry Smith .vb
31949c86fc7SBarry Smith   PetscCall(ierr);  // check if ierr is nonzero
32049c86fc7SBarry Smith .ve
32149c86fc7SBarry Smith 
322792fecdfSBarry Smith   Should not be used to call callback functions provided by users, `PetscCallBack()` should be used in that situation.
323ef1023bdSBarry Smith 
324*6a8be23eSBarry Smith   `PetscUseTypeMethod()` or `PetscTryTypeMethod()` should be used when calling functions pointers contained in a PETSc object's `ops` array
325*6a8be23eSBarry Smith 
32649c86fc7SBarry Smith   Fortran Notes:
32749c86fc7SBarry Smith     The Fortran function from which this is used must declare a variable PetscErrorCode ierr and ierr must be
32849c86fc7SBarry Smith     the final argument to the PetscFunction being called.
32949c86fc7SBarry Smith 
33049c86fc7SBarry Smith     In the main program and in Fortran subroutines that do not have ierr as the final return parameter one
33149c86fc7SBarry Smith     should use PetscCallA()
33249c86fc7SBarry Smith 
33349c86fc7SBarry Smith   Example Fortran Usage:
33449c86fc7SBarry Smith .vb
33549c86fc7SBarry Smith   PetscErrorCode ierr
33649c86fc7SBarry Smith   Vec v
33749c86fc7SBarry Smith 
33849c86fc7SBarry Smith   ...
33949c86fc7SBarry Smith   PetscCall(VecShift(v,1.0,ierr))
34049c86fc7SBarry Smith   PetscCallA(VecShift(v,1.0,ierr))
34149c86fc7SBarry Smith .ve
34249c86fc7SBarry Smith 
3439566063dSJacob Faibussowitsch   Level: beginner
3449566063dSJacob Faibussowitsch 
34549c86fc7SBarry Smith .seealso: `SETERRQ()`, `PetscCheck()`, `PetscAssert()`, `PetscTraceBackErrorHandler()`, `PetscCallMPI()`
346792fecdfSBarry Smith           `PetscPushErrorHandler()`, `PetscError()`, `CHKMEMQ`, `CHKERRA()`, `CHKERRMPI()`, `PetscCallBack()`
3479566063dSJacob Faibussowitsch M*/

4319566063dSJacob Faibussowitsch /*MC
4329566063dSJacob Faibussowitsch   PetscCallMPI - Checks error code returned from MPI calls, if non-zero it calls the error
4339566063dSJacob Faibussowitsch   handler and then returns
4349566063dSJacob Faibussowitsch 
4359566063dSJacob Faibussowitsch   Synopsis:
4369566063dSJacob Faibussowitsch   #include <petscerror.h>
43749c86fc7SBarry Smith   void PetscCallMPI(MPI_Function(args))
43830de9b25SBarry Smith 
439eca87e8dSBarry Smith   Not Collective
44030de9b25SBarry Smith 
44130de9b25SBarry Smith   Input Parameters:
44249c86fc7SBarry Smith . MPI_Function - an MPI function that returns an MPI error code
44330de9b25SBarry Smith 
4449566063dSJacob Faibussowitsch   Notes:
4459566063dSJacob Faibussowitsch   Always returns the error code PETSC_ERR_MPI; the MPI error code and string are embedded in
4469566063dSJacob Faibussowitsch   the string error message. Do not use this to call any other routines (for example PETSc
4479566063dSJacob Faibussowitsch   routines), it should only be used for direct MPI calls. Due to limitations of the
4489566063dSJacob Faibussowitsch   preprocessor this can unfortunately not easily be enforced, so the user should take care to
4499566063dSJacob Faibussowitsch   check this themselves.
4509566063dSJacob Faibussowitsch 
4519566063dSJacob Faibussowitsch   Example Usage:
4529566063dSJacob Faibussowitsch .vb
4539566063dSJacob Faibussowitsch   PetscCallMPI(MPI_Comm_size(...)); // OK, calling MPI function
4549566063dSJacob Faibussowitsch 
4559566063dSJacob Faibussowitsch   PetscCallMPI(PetscFunction(...)); // ERROR, use PetscCall() instead!
4569566063dSJacob Faibussowitsch .ve
4579566063dSJacob Faibussowitsch 
45849c86fc7SBarry Smith   Fortran Notes:
45949c86fc7SBarry Smith     The Fortran function from which this is used must declare a variable PetscErrorCode ierr and ierr must be
46049c86fc7SBarry Smith     the final argument to the MPI function being called.
46149c86fc7SBarry Smith 
46249c86fc7SBarry Smith     In the main program and in Fortran subroutines that do not have ierr as the final return parameter one
46349c86fc7SBarry Smith     should use PetscCallMPIA()
46449c86fc7SBarry Smith 
46549c86fc7SBarry Smith   Fortran Usage:
46649c86fc7SBarry Smith .vb
46749c86fc7SBarry Smith   PetscErrorCode ierr or integer ierr
46849c86fc7SBarry Smith   ...
46949c86fc7SBarry Smith   PetscCallMPI(MPI_Comm_size(...,ierr))
47049c86fc7SBarry Smith   PetscCallMPIA(MPI_Comm_size(...,ierr)) ! Will abort after calling error handler
47149c86fc7SBarry Smith 
47249c86fc7SBarry Smith   PetscCallMPI(MPI_Comm_size(...,eflag)) ! ERROR, final argument must be ierr
47349c86fc7SBarry Smith .ve
47449c86fc7SBarry Smith 
47530de9b25SBarry Smith   Level: beginner
47630de9b25SBarry Smith 
477db781477SPatrick Sanan .seealso: `SETERRMPI()`, `PetscCall()`, `SETERRQ()`, `SETERRABORT()`, `PetscCallAbort()`,
478db781477SPatrick Sanan           `PetscTraceBackErrorHandler()`, `PetscPushErrorHandler()`, `PetscError()`, `CHKMEMQ`
47930de9b25SBarry Smith M*/

5199566063dSJacob Faibussowitsch /*MC
5209566063dSJacob Faibussowitsch   PetscCallAbort - Checks error code returned from PETSc function, if non-zero it aborts immediately
5219566063dSJacob Faibussowitsch 
5229566063dSJacob Faibussowitsch   Synopsis:
5239566063dSJacob Faibussowitsch   #include <petscerror.h>
5249566063dSJacob Faibussowitsch   void PetscCallAbort(MPI_Comm comm, PetscErrorCode ierr)
5259566063dSJacob Faibussowitsch 
5269566063dSJacob Faibussowitsch   Collective on comm
5279566063dSJacob Faibussowitsch 
5289566063dSJacob Faibussowitsch   Input Parameters:
5299566063dSJacob Faibussowitsch + comm - the MPI communicator on which to abort
5309566063dSJacob Faibussowitsch - ierr - nonzero error code, see the list of standard error codes in include/petscerror.h
5319566063dSJacob Faibussowitsch 
5329566063dSJacob Faibussowitsch   Notes:
5339566063dSJacob Faibussowitsch   This macro has identical type and usage semantics to PetscCall() with the important caveat
5349566063dSJacob Faibussowitsch   that this macro does not return. Instead, if ierr is nonzero it calls the PETSc error handler
5359566063dSJacob Faibussowitsch   and then immediately calls MPI_Abort(). It can therefore be used anywhere.
5369566063dSJacob Faibussowitsch 
5379566063dSJacob Faibussowitsch   As per MPI_Abort semantics the communicator passed must be valid, although there is currently
5389566063dSJacob Faibussowitsch   no attempt made at handling any potential errors from MPI_Abort(). Note that while
5399566063dSJacob Faibussowitsch   MPI_Abort() is required to terminate only those processes which reside on comm, it is often
5409566063dSJacob Faibussowitsch   the case that MPI_Abort() terminates *all* processes.
5419566063dSJacob Faibussowitsch 
5429566063dSJacob Faibussowitsch   Example Usage:
5439566063dSJacob Faibussowitsch .vb
5449566063dSJacob Faibussowitsch   PetscErrorCode boom(void) { return PETSC_ERR_MEM; }
5459566063dSJacob Faibussowitsch 
5469566063dSJacob Faibussowitsch   void foo(void)
5479566063dSJacob Faibussowitsch   {
5489566063dSJacob Faibussowitsch     PetscCallAbort(PETSC_COMM_WORLD,boom()); // OK, does not return a type
5499566063dSJacob Faibussowitsch   }
5509566063dSJacob Faibussowitsch 
5519566063dSJacob Faibussowitsch   double bar(void)
5529566063dSJacob Faibussowitsch   {
5539566063dSJacob Faibussowitsch     PetscCallAbort(PETSC_COMM_WORLD,boom()); // OK, does not return a type
5549566063dSJacob Faibussowitsch   }
5559566063dSJacob Faibussowitsch 
5569566063dSJacob Faibussowitsch   PetscCallAbort(MPI_COMM_NULL,boom()); // ERROR, communicator should be valid
5579566063dSJacob Faibussowitsch 
5589566063dSJacob Faibussowitsch   struct baz
5599566063dSJacob Faibussowitsch   {
5609566063dSJacob Faibussowitsch     baz()
5619566063dSJacob Faibussowitsch     {
5629566063dSJacob Faibussowitsch       PetscCallAbort(PETSC_COMM_SELF,boom()); // OK
5639566063dSJacob Faibussowitsch     }
5649566063dSJacob Faibussowitsch 
5659566063dSJacob Faibussowitsch     ~baz()
5669566063dSJacob Faibussowitsch     {
5679566063dSJacob Faibussowitsch       PetscCallAbort(PETSC_COMM_SELF,boom()); // OK (in fact the only way to handle PETSc errors)
5689566063dSJacob Faibussowitsch     }
5699566063dSJacob Faibussowitsch   };
5709566063dSJacob Faibussowitsch .ve
5719566063dSJacob Faibussowitsch 
5729566063dSJacob Faibussowitsch   Level: intermediate
5739566063dSJacob Faibussowitsch 
574db781477SPatrick Sanan .seealso: `SETERRABORT()`, `PetscTraceBackErrorHandler()`, `PetscPushErrorHandler()`, `PetscError()`,
575db781477SPatrick Sanan           `SETERRQ()`, `CHKMEMQ`, `PetscCallMPI()`
5769566063dSJacob Faibussowitsch M*/

7363f520e80SJunchao Zhang /*MC
7379566063dSJacob Faibussowitsch   PetscCallCXX - Checks C++ function calls and if they throw an exception, catch it and then
7389566063dSJacob Faibussowitsch   return a PETSc error code
7393f520e80SJunchao Zhang 
7403f520e80SJunchao Zhang   Synopsis:
7419566063dSJacob Faibussowitsch   #include <petscerror.h>
7429566063dSJacob Faibussowitsch   void PetscCallCXX(expr) noexcept;
7433f520e80SJunchao Zhang 
7443f520e80SJunchao Zhang   Not Collective
7453f520e80SJunchao Zhang 
7469566063dSJacob Faibussowitsch   Input Parameter:
7479566063dSJacob Faibussowitsch . expr - An arbitrary expression
7483f520e80SJunchao Zhang 
7493f520e80SJunchao Zhang   Notes:
7509566063dSJacob Faibussowitsch   PetscCallCXX(expr) is a macro replacement for
7519566063dSJacob Faibussowitsch .vb
7529566063dSJacob Faibussowitsch   try {
7539566063dSJacob Faibussowitsch     expr;
7549566063dSJacob Faibussowitsch   } catch (const std::exception& e) {
7559566063dSJacob Faibussowitsch     return ConvertToPetscErrorCode(e);
7569566063dSJacob Faibussowitsch   }
7579566063dSJacob Faibussowitsch .ve
7589566063dSJacob Faibussowitsch   Due to the fact that it catches any (reasonable) exception, it is essentially noexcept.
7593f520e80SJunchao Zhang 
7609566063dSJacob Faibussowitsch   Example Usage:
7619566063dSJacob Faibussowitsch .vb
7629566063dSJacob Faibussowitsch   void foo(void) { throw std::runtime_error("error"); }
7633f520e80SJunchao Zhang 
7649566063dSJacob Faibussowitsch   void bar()
7659566063dSJacob Faibussowitsch   {
766e8952933SJacob Faibussowitsch     PetscCallCXX(foo()); // ERROR bar() does not return PetscErrorCode
7679566063dSJacob Faibussowitsch   }
7689566063dSJacob Faibussowitsch 
7699566063dSJacob Faibussowitsch   PetscErrorCode baz()
7709566063dSJacob Faibussowitsch   {
7719566063dSJacob Faibussowitsch     PetscCallCXX(foo()); // OK
7729566063dSJacob Faibussowitsch 
7739566063dSJacob Faibussowitsch     PetscCallCXX(
7749566063dSJacob Faibussowitsch       bar();
775e8952933SJacob Faibussowitsch       foo(); // OK mutliple statements allowed
7769566063dSJacob Faibussowitsch     );
7779566063dSJacob Faibussowitsch   }
7789566063dSJacob Faibussowitsch 
7799566063dSJacob Faibussowitsch   struct bop
7809566063dSJacob Faibussowitsch   {
7819566063dSJacob Faibussowitsch     bop()
7829566063dSJacob Faibussowitsch     {
783e8952933SJacob Faibussowitsch       PetscCallCXX(foo()); // ERROR returns PetscErrorCode, cannot be used in constructors
7849566063dSJacob Faibussowitsch     }
7859566063dSJacob Faibussowitsch   };
7869566063dSJacob Faibussowitsch 
787e8952933SJacob Faibussowitsch   // ERROR contains do-while, cannot be used as function-try block
7889566063dSJacob Faibussowitsch   PetscErrorCode qux() PetscCallCXX(
7899566063dSJacob Faibussowitsch     bar();
7909566063dSJacob Faibussowitsch     baz();
7919566063dSJacob Faibussowitsch     foo();
7929566063dSJacob Faibussowitsch     return 0;
7939566063dSJacob Faibussowitsch   )
7949566063dSJacob Faibussowitsch .ve
7959566063dSJacob Faibussowitsch 
79649762cbcSSatish Balay   Level: beginner
79749762cbcSSatish Balay 
798db781477SPatrick Sanan .seealso: `PetscCallThrow()`, `SETERRQ()`, `PetscCall()`, `SETERRABORT()`, `PetscCallAbort()`,
799db781477SPatrick Sanan           `PetscTraceBackErrorHandler()`, `PetscPushErrorHandler()`, `PetscError()`, `CHKMEMQ`
8003f520e80SJunchao Zhang M*/
